WARNING
Reduce the fuel pressure before loosen-
ing the vapor separator drain screw, or
pressurized fuel will spray out and may
result in serious injury.
Removing the fuel hose clamp
1.
Remove the fuel hose clamp by cutting
the crimped section of the clamp.
CAUTION:
If the fuel hose clamp is removed without
cutting the crimp first, the fuel hose will
be damaged.
Installing the fuel hose clamp
1.
Crimp the fuel hose clamp properly to
securely fasten it.
WARNING
Do not reuse the fuel hose clamp, always
replace it with a new one.
Disassembling the vapor separator
1.
Remove the float chamber, float pin, and
float.
NOTE:
Remove the float pin in the direction of the
arrow
a
shown.
2.
Remove the needle valve and other com-
ponents.
Checking the vapor separator
1.
Check the needle valve for bends or
wear. Replace if necessary.
